Case Discussion
Trochanteric fractures are those which involve greater and/or lesser trochanters of the femur and are classified into:
- intertrochanteric fracture
- pertrochanteric fracture
- subtrochanteric fracture
- isolated greater trochanteric avulsion fracture
- lesser trochanteric avulsion fracture
